English Conversation Questions on Raising children

  • What are your thoughts on parenting styles? Do you believe in a more strict or lenient approach?
  • How do you feel about using punishment as a means of discipline for children?
  • What is your stance on allowing children to make their own decisions, even if they go against your wishes or values?
  • Do you believe that children should be held to the same expectations and responsibilities as adults, or should they be given more leniency?
  • How do you feel about using technology and screen time as a way to occupy or entertain children?
  • What is your opinion on the role of schooling and education in raising children?
  • Do you believe that children should be exposed to a wide range of experiences, or do you think it’s important to protect them from certain things?
  • How do you approach the topic of sex education with your children (or future children)?
  • What is your stance on physical punishment (e.g. spanking) as a means of discipline for children?
  • Do you believe in the concept of “tough love” when it comes to raising children?
  • What is your approach to setting boundaries and rules for children? How do you enforce them?
